2008 Grivault Albert Bourgogne Blanc

By billn on September 30, 2010

Higher-toned. There’s more density too, but still a hint of must dovetails with the sweet fruit. Lovely flavours; the richer sweetness of 2008 mixed with its super acidity – I like!

2008 Dublère Bourgogne Blanc

By billn on June 30, 2010

Cuvée Millerandes. Fresh with a super-intense core of fruit. Plenty of acidity but it has the foil of a rippling width of flavour. Stony fruit in the mid-palate. One critic ordered 6 cases after tasting this – I ordered a more modest one, which was clearly a mistake as they lasted only 2 months – then the domaine was sold out! One of the bourgognes of the vintage.

2008 Ropiteau Frères Bourgogne Blanc

By billn on April 13, 2010

A little oak toast mingles with the high tones. There’s a small burst of interest in the mouth, but this is essentially a little flat. Okay…
